Five Kids Fall Through Frozen Lake in Shocking Solihull Rescue Drama

Emergency services rushed to Babbs Mill Lake in Solihull after a chilling incident late Sunday afternoon. Around 4pm, five children playing on the frozen lake plunged through the ice, sparking a massive rescue operation.

Massive Emergency Response on Scene

Paramedics, police officers, and firefighters swarmed the beauty spot near Fordbridge Road and Stonebridge Crescent. Multiple police cars, ambulances, and fire trucks blocked off the area as specialist water rescue teams went into action.

Critical Condition Patients Airlifted to Hospital

West Midlands Fire Service confirmed that their water rescue squad swiftly took control, using specialist gear to pull the victims to safety. Several people have been rushed to hospital in critical condition, receiving life-saving treatment on-site from both firefighters and ambulance crews.

Authorities Urge Public to Stay Clear

“We are currently on the scene of a serious incident at Babbs Mill Park,” said West Midlands Police. “We ask the public to allow emergency services to carry out their work safely and effectively.”

The search and rescue effort remains ongoing, with police, fire, and ambulance teams working closely to manage the situation. More updates will be released as the story develops.
